"PermaWash" or "Hypo Clearing Agent" - OPTIONAL "PermaWash" or "Hypo Clearing Agent" is used to reduce washing times of prints - only needed if you are using fiber based papers or if you intend to tone the prints. If you are short on fresh water or pay for the amount of water that you use, then this is worth looking into as the clearing agent will cut your washing times dramatically. Normal, untoned prints, using resin coated paper, do not need to be treated with "PermaWash" or "Hypo Clearing Agent", as the washing time is only 5 minutes. Generally follow the manufacturers directions, or the times listed at the bottom of this page. Wash water should be approximately 68 degrees Fahrenheit.
